Fairmont Tokyo Debuts in Shibaura with Panoramic Views

Tokyo, Japan – July 30, 2025 — Fairmont Hotels & Resorts has officially made its debut in Japan with the grand opening of Fairmont Tokyo, marking a milestone for the luxury brand’s expansion into one of Asia’s most vibrant capitals. Located in the upscale Shibaura district of Minato City, Fairmont Tokyo opened its doors on July 1, 2025, bringing with it a fusion of modern luxury and traditional Japanese hospitality, or omotenashi.

Occupying the 35th to 43rd floors of a striking new tower, Fairmont Tokyo offers panoramic views of Tokyo Tower, Rainbow Bridge, and the sparkling waters of Tokyo Bay. The hotel’s design philosophy elegantly intertwines timeless Japanese aesthetics with contemporary international sophistication, creating a destination that appeals equally to leisure travelers and business executives.

Strategic Location with Seamless Connectivity

Fairmont Tokyo enjoys a premium location just minutes from major commercial hubs and cultural landmarks. Haneda Airport is a quick 13-minute drive, while both Tokyo and Shinagawa Stations can be reached in under 10 minutes. This accessibility positions the hotel as a gateway for exploring Tokyo’s top destinations—from the historic temples of Asakusa to the bustling streets of Ginza and the tranquil beauty of Hamarikyu Gardens.

The neighborhood of Shibaura, undergoing rapid urban renewal, sits at the intersection of business, residential, and leisure life. Fairmont Tokyo adds to this transformation, offering a luxurious urban retreat that blends skyline elegance with Tokyo’s dynamic energy.

Luxurious Rooms and Thoughtful Japanese Design

The hotel offers 219 rooms and suites ranging from 52 to 278 square meters. Each space is designed by Australia-based BAR Studio, reflecting a contemporary take on Japanese tradition. Elements like Kintsugi-inspired design, washi paper textures, and Kumiko woodworking patterns provide an immersive sense of place.

Floor-to-ceiling windows frame breathtaking views of the metropolis, while the interiors promote serenity and mindfulness. The 29 suites offer elevated experiences, including private lounges and personalized concierge services. Every guest, whether arriving for business or leisure, is enveloped in a calming, refined environment that balances Tokyo’s fast pace with restorative tranquility.

Culinary Excellence Across Seven Distinct Venues

Fairmont Tokyo offers seven signature dining and bar concepts that celebrate Tokyo’s diverse gastronomic scene:

  • Kiln & Tonic: A rooftop brasserie with wood-fired cuisine and cocktails overlooking Tokyo Tower.
  • Vue Mer: A stylish lounge blending French and Japanese café culture with Tokyo Bay views.
  • Migiwa: A reimagined sushi experience, merging innovation with reverence for tradition.
  • Totsuji: Modern teppanyaki artistry delivered with elegance.
  • Driftwood: A Yoshoku-style restaurant offering nostalgic Western-Japanese fusion cuisine.
  • Yoi to Yoi: Elevated Japanese street food in a relaxed, highball-friendly setting.
  • Speakeasy Bar: A hidden cocktail lounge with vinyl soundtracks and premium spirits.

Each outlet is designed to reflect both global influences and local ingredients, with menus that shift with the seasons.

Wellness at Its Finest

Wellness takes center stage at Fairmont Spa & Health Club, located on the 35th floor. Guests can indulge in holistic spa treatments inspired by traditional Japanese rituals and powered by Fairmont’s signature product lines, including Canada’s Au Natural and the new Spalutions range.

The spa experience is complemented by a 24-hour fitness center with cutting-edge Technogym equipment, group training studios, and a 20-meter indoor infinity pool. A sundeck and fireplace-equipped observation terrace offer guests opportunities to unwind while enjoying sweeping views of Tokyo’s skyline and bay.

A Symbolic Grand Opening for Fairmont and Accor

The July 1 opening was marked by a ribbon-cutting ceremony attended by representatives from Accor, Fairmont’s parent company, and Japan-based developer Nomura Real Estate Development Co., Ltd. The collaboration signals a new era for the Fairmont brand in Asia, one of the world’s fastest-growing luxury hospitality markets.

Accor aims to expand its luxury and lifestyle hotel footprint in Japan with more strategic partnerships and curated experiences. The Tokyo opening reinforces Accor’s vision of combining local cultural immersion with global standards of luxury.
